
A man has been arrested on suspicion of attempted burglary following reports of suspicious activity around homes in Derry.
It was reported that two men were trying the door handles of a car and a house in Hillview Avenue at around 3.20am yesterday morning.
One of the men, aged 34, was later spotted on a bike and in possession of a set of car keys which were not his own and two screwdrivers and was arrested on suspicion of going equipped for burglary, attempted burglary and vehicle interference. He has since been released on bail.
Police are continuing efforts to locate the second man, wearing a balaclava at the time, and are appealing to anyone with information to get in touch.
